 I have a 2006 2.2cdti sport FR-V.

 

I love it and so does our 10 year old in the middle seat:-)

 

I recently had to do a couple of thousand miles in a matter of three weeks - the car has already done 166,000 miles, but has never missed a beat.

 

The car drives great, but I have noticed it is taking longer to crank.

 

it would previously start in a second , but now it i taking between 2-5 ?

 

One started , it drives fine, no loss of power,etc, and doing a reasonable 41-44 mpg on a run. ( I am not a boy racer :-) )

 

I am not a mechanic but should I be concerned , as I have to do another  thousand miles over the next two weeks.

 

This is motorway driving.

Sounds like it could be the fuel filter needs changing.
This can result in less fuel in the canister and taking longer to prime up

You can tell if this is the case as the rubber bulb takes more to pump up to get firmer which suggests this is the case
